Transaction 55143f30606427993c59cd4674e482134acc3811fbb0a56dd84b8768f03e2ed8

1 Input
2 Outputs
  • 55143f30606427993c59cd4674e482134acc3811fbb0a56dd84b8768f03e2ed8:0
  • value  57000000
    address  3Qn2h6ThikwVKSqyC9FvrhTRLq4TW68hyE
  • 55143f30606427993c59cd4674e482134acc3811fbb0a56dd84b8768f03e2ed8:1
  • value  405144803
    address  34Ftzy6ijfZFJDBnsFnAEJT2XKykbmsZTo